Lenham is a picturesque, medieval market village located on the edge of the North Downs. It has a rich history that dates back to at least the 11th century, as it is mentioned in the Domesday Book of 1086.
The village contains many independent businesses and cafes, including a fish restaurant, a hotel and bar and beauty rooms. There is also a medical centre, church and community centre.
Further shops and services are located in the larger towns
of Maidstone and Ashford. Lenham benefits from both rural walks and countryside surroundings, with village amenities and good transport links to London, Ashford and Maidstone.
Lenham Primary School and The Lenham School -
a coeducational secondary school with a sixth form -
are both located nearby, while Ashford and Maidstone also offers a range of both state, grammar and independent schools.
Lenham benefits from excellent transport links, with
frequent bus and train services easily accessible nearby. Journey times from Lenham station to Ashford International are approximately 22mins and from Lenham station to Victoria, London from 1 hour 30.
